PriceFest 2021: A New Black Renaissance
So Many Ways to Support PriceFest 2021! For the past several months, The International Florence Price Festival, has been meeting to organize our 2nd annual festival. This year's festival entitled PriceFest 2021: A New Black Renaissance will help us to achieve our mission to celebrate the life and legacy of composer Florence Beatrice Price by providing a platform through performances of Price's works alongside historic and new works by Black composers. I am so excited for all of the more than 12 hours of diverse content including: The premiere of My Lisette - A documentary on the evolution of Haitian folksong Performances by renowned artists including Marquita Lister, Melissa Givens, and Kevin Wayne Bumpers! Eric Conway: Opera at Morgan continues to flourish during period of remote instruction!
till the new day Never Taking Wing? Martin Luther King, Jr. Dr. Eric Conway writes: Hello Morgan Fine and Performing Arts community! Once again, teachers and students in Morgan’s Fine and Performing Arts department are finding ways to continue their craft during this period of remote education. Morgan’s opera program, led by Vocal Coordinator Marquita Lister, produced an opera entitled: Freedom Dreams - a virtual performance of operatic arias around current themes in our society. Students enrolled in our Opera Workshop course were given arias to sing and asked to connect these arias with essays around issues in contemporary society. The product yielded profound social commentaries, with insights into our society that national pundits should absorb.
